Health Care Providers On Central, South Coast Say Coronavirus Tests Reserved For Those With Symptoms

Healthcare providers on the Central and South Coasts are trying to get out the word on an aspect of the coronavirus concern which has left them swamped with phone calls. The issue is tests. Some people have been contacting healthcare providers seeking tests to make sure they aren’t infected. Health Care officials say if you aren’t showing possible symptoms, you will not be tested.

Health care providers do have test kits, but they are being saved for people who show signs of having the virus. If you are showing serious flulike symptoms, that’s the time to contact your primary healthcare provider and they can decide whether a test is warranted.
